The artistic world is constantly evolving, with new styles and creators emerging to challenge conventional norms. Among the more intriguing and often discussed figures in this contemporary landscape is spino gambino. His work, often a blend of digital art, performance, and social commentary, has garnered a dedicated following and sparked considerable debate within the art community and beyond. The exploration of identity, technology, and the human condition frequently surfaces in his pieces, making them both compelling and thought-provoking.

What distinguishes spino gambino from many of his contemporaries is his unconventional approach to creation and dissemination. He actively utilizes online platforms—not merely as galleries, but as integral components of the art itself, fostering interactive experiences for his audience. This engagement extends beyond passive consumption, often incorporating elements of participatory creation, blurring the lines between artist and audience. The influence of internet culture is evident throughout his body of work, reflecting a generation that has grown up immersed in the digital realm.

The Digital Canvas and Shifting Aesthetics

Spino gambino’s preferred medium is undeniably digital, heavily influenced by the aesthetics of early internet graphics, glitch art, and cyberpunk. He frequently employs vibrant color palettes, distorted imagery, and fragmented narratives to create a sense of unease and disorientation. This aesthetic isn't merely stylistic; it’s a deliberate attempt to reflect the fractured nature of contemporary experience, particularly the overwhelming stream of information and stimuli we encounter daily. He uses digital processes not just to reproduce existing forms, but to invent entirely new visual languages that challenge traditional artistic conventions. There’s a purposeful roughness to the digital brushstrokes, eschewing the hyper-realism often sought by digital artists in favor of a more raw and immediate aesthetic.

The Role of Nostalgia in Digital Art

A recurring theme within spino gambino’s work is a nostalgic longing for the early days of the internet. The pixelated graphics, rudimentary animations, and dial-up modem sounds of the 1990s and early 2000s are not simply referenced, but actively incorporated into his creations. This isn’t simply a case of retro aesthetics; rather, it's a commentary on the loss of innocence and the increasing commercialization of the online world. The early internet promised a space of freedom, creativity, and connection, and this sense of possibility is something he often attempts to recapture within his art. The visual cues act as triggers, reminding viewers of a time when the digital realm felt new and untamed, before algorithms and targeted advertising dominated the online experience.

Performance, Interaction, and the Blurring of Boundaries

Spino gambino’s art extends beyond the static image, frequently incorporating live performance and interactive elements. His performances often take place online, utilizing platforms such as Twitch and Discord to engage directly with his audience. These aren't traditional performances in the theatrical sense; instead, they are often chaotic, improvisational events that challenge the expectations of both the artist and the viewer. He frequently employs digital avatars and virtual environments, further blurring the lines between the physical and digital realms. The goal isn't necessarily to create a polished and refined spectacle, but rather to foster a sense of collective exploration and shared experience.

The Concept of the "Living Artwork"

Central to spino gambino’s practice is the idea of the “living artwork,” a piece that isn’t fixed or finalized, but rather constantly evolving through interaction with its audience. This concept challenges the traditional notion of the artist as the sole creator and the artwork as a static object. Instead, the audience becomes an active participant in the creation process, shaping the artwork through their contributions and responses. This participatory element is crucial to understanding his work, as it fundamentally alters the relationship between artist, artwork, and audience. By relinquishing control and embracing chance encounters, he creates a space for genuine collaboration and unexpected outcomes.

Social Commentary and the Critique of Digital Culture

While aesthetically captivating, spino gambino's work is often deeply rooted in social commentary, critiquing the pervasive influence of technology and the anxieties of the digital age. He frequently addresses themes such as surveillance, data privacy, and the commodification of personal information, using his art as a platform for raising awareness and sparking critical discussion. His pieces don’t offer easy answers, but rather pose complex questions about the ethical implications of technological advancements and the erosion of individual autonomy. He often employs satire and irony to highlight the absurdities of contemporary society, forcing viewers to confront uncomfortable truths about the world we inhabit.

The Impact of Algorithmic Bias

A particularly prominent theme in spino gambino’s work is the issue of algorithmic bias. He explores how algorithms, often presented as objective and neutral, can perpetuate and amplify existing social inequalities. Through his art, he seeks to expose the hidden biases embedded within these systems, revealing how they can discriminate against marginalized communities and reinforce harmful stereotypes. He highlights the danger of blindly trusting in technology, urging viewers to critically examine the assumptions and values that underpin these systems. This examination is often presented in a visually jarring and unsettling manner, designed to provoke a visceral reaction and compel viewers to question their own complicity in perpetuating these biases.

The Evolution of the Spino Gambino Aesthetic

Tracing the arc of spino gambino’s career reveals a continuous evolution of style and technique. While certain core themes and aesthetics remain consistent, his work has become increasingly sophisticated and nuanced over time. Early pieces were characterized by a raw, chaotic energy, reflecting the early experimentation with digital tools and the influence of internet subcultures. More recent works demonstrate a greater level of polish and refinement, incorporating elements of 3D modeling, animation, and sound design. This doesn’t represent a abandonment of his original aesthetic, but rather a natural progression as he develops his artistic skills and explores new creative possibilities.

He has actively collaborated with other artists, musicians, and programmers, further diversifying his creative practice and expanding his artistic horizons. These collaborations often result in unexpected and innovative outcomes, pushing the boundaries of what is possible within the digital realm. The willingness to experiment and embrace new technologies remains a defining characteristic of his artistic approach. This adaptability is crucial in a rapidly evolving digital landscape, allowing him to stay at the forefront of artistic innovation.

Beyond the Screen: Expanding into Physical Spaces

While primarily known for his digital work, spino gambino has recently begun to explore the possibilities of translating his art into physical spaces. He’s experimented with creating immersive installations that combine digital projections, soundscapes, and interactive elements, transforming galleries and other unconventional venues into multisensory environments. These installations offer a unique and engaging experience for viewers, allowing them to step inside the world of spino gambino’s creations and interact with them on a deeper level. This move beyond the screen demonstrates a desire to reach a wider audience and explore the potential of art to create tangible, embodied experiences.

The challenge lies in translating the ephemeral nature of digital art into a physical form, capturing the same sense of fluidity and dynamism that characterizes his online work. However, he appears to be successfully navigating this challenge, creating installations that are both visually stunning and intellectually stimulating.
